Beschrijving uitgever
This book comes at a time when
virtual organizations (VO) are proliferating exponentially due to the twin
catalysts of globalization and technological enablement. It provides conceptual
frameworks and simple tools for identifying and addressing the complexities of
managing geographically dispersed, virtually linked organizations, which may
have grown organically or inorganically into a potpourri of multiple cultures,
capabilities and practices. These can help to scientifically assess the impact
of virtualization, balance the physical with the virtual and manage risks using
early indicators. As ensuring knowledge transfer effectiveness (KTE) is vital
in VOs, a diagnostic tool has been evolved to measure KTE, isolate problems and
weak links and plan effective interventions. Moreover, a set of critical
factors that could increase the chances of an organization’s globalization
strategies succeeding have been identified. This book interleaves theory with
practice and provides insights drawn from conversations with business leaders,
exploratory surveys, and in-depth research using a large sample.
